Air pollution: What are the health impacts?
Objective: To present the results of the second phase of the PSAS-9 program regarding the health impacts of urban air pollution. The relative risks associated with short-term exposure to air pollution and health indicators are relatively low; however, since the entire urban population is exposed to air pollution, the number of attributable cases is far from negligible.
